Optical Ground Wire Market Set to Reach USD 4.8 Billion by 2032, Driven by Grid Modernization and Renewable Integration
The global Optical Ground Wire market is witnessing steady expansion, fueled by rapid grid modernization initiatives and the rising integration of renewable energy sources. As part of the broader Energy & Power industry under the Storage, Transmission & Distribution segment, Optical Ground Wire (OPGW) plays a pivotal role in ensuring reliable communication and protection within high-voltage transmission lines. According to the latest analysis by Market Intelo, the Optical Ground Wire market was valued at USD 2.6 billion in 2023 and is projected to reach USD 4.8 billion by 2032, expanding at a CAGR of 7.2% during the forecast period.
The increasing demand for resilient and smart power infrastructure is propelling utilities to adopt advanced transmission technologies. OPGW combines the functions of grounding and fiber optic communication, enabling real-time monitoring, fault detection, and data transmission across power networks. This dual functionality enhances operational efficiency and reduces downtime, making it an essential component of modern energy systems.

Key Market Drivers
Rising Investments in Grid Modernization
Governments worldwide are allocating substantial budgets to modernize transmission and distribution infrastructure. Aging power grids, particularly in developed economies, require replacement with advanced systems capable of handling fluctuating loads and distributed energy resources. OPGW offers an integrated approach by combining lightning protection and high-speed data communication in a single cable, reducing installation costs and enhancing system performance.
Expansion of Renewable Energy Projects
The global shift toward clean energy is a significant growth catalyst for the Optical Ground Wire market. Renewable installations often span remote areas, necessitating robust communication links to maintain grid synchronization. OPGW ensures secure and reliable data transmission, enabling efficient integration of renewable sources into national grids.
Growing Emphasis on Smart Grid Technologies
Smart grid deployment is accelerating across regions, driven by the need for automated monitoring and predictive maintenance. Optical Ground Wire supports advanced telecommunication systems required for Supervisory Control and Data Acquisition (SCADA) and other grid management applications. This integration improves outage management and reduces operational costs for utilities.
Market Restraints and Challenges
Despite strong growth prospects, the Optical Ground Wire market faces certain challenges. High initial installation costs and complex deployment procedures may deter small-scale utilities. Additionally, fluctuating raw material prices, particularly aluminum and steel, can impact production costs and profit margins.
However, technological advancements and economies of scale are expected to mitigate these challenges over the forecast period. Manufacturers are focusing on lightweight designs and improved fiber capacity to enhance efficiency while reducing costs.

Regional Insights
Asia-Pacific Leads the Market
Asia-Pacific dominates the global Optical Ground Wire market, accounting for over 38% of total revenue in 2023. Rapid industrialization, expanding urban infrastructure, and significant investments in renewable energy projects across China, India, and Southeast Asia are key contributors to regional growth. Government initiatives aimed at strengthening grid reliability further support market expansion.
North America and Europe Show Steady Growth
North America holds a substantial market share, driven by ongoing grid modernization programs and the replacement of aging transmission lines. The United States continues to invest in smart grid projects to enhance resilience against extreme weather events.
Europe is also witnessing increased adoption of OPGW solutions due to stringent energy efficiency regulations and the region’s strong commitment to renewable energy integration. Countries such as Germany and the United Kingdom are actively upgrading transmission networks to accommodate offshore wind installations.
Emerging Markets in Latin America and Middle East & Africa
Developing economies in Latin America and the Middle East & Africa are gradually increasing investments in power infrastructure. Rising electricity demand and cross-border transmission projects are expected to create new opportunities for Optical Ground Wire manufacturers in these regions.

Market Segmentation
By Type
-
Central Tube OPGW
-
Layer Stranding OPGW
Central tube designs are preferred for installations requiring compact structures and enhanced protection for optical fibers, while layer stranding configurations offer higher fiber counts and improved mechanical performance.
